Role Overview
National Bank of Pakistan (NBP), a leading financial institution, is seeking a talented and experienced Infrastructure Security Analyst (OG-I / AVP) to join their Information Technology team in Karachi. This role focuses on maintaining and enhancing the security posture of the bank's IT infrastructure.Reporting Structure
The Infrastructure Security Analyst will report directly to the Unit Head – Infrastructure Security & Compliance.Key Responsibilities
- Maintain the security and compliance of the organization's technological infrastructure (IT systems, networks, hardware, software, data centers).
- Analyze logs from network security devices and server infrastructure.
- Provide management reporting on security compliance according to organizational standards and best practices.
- Perform triage analysis on endpoint security solutions.
- Conduct vulnerability assessments for network applications and operating systems.
- Manage the integration of network appliances, Windows, Linux, and databases with SIEM.
- Perform daily security tasks, including updating Indicators of Compromise (IOC) and other security controls.
- Create and develop dashboards, identify anomalies, and report exceptions.
- Analyze phishing emails and respond accordingly.
- Stay updated with emerging security threats and update teams.
- Participate in vulnerability management processes, including evaluation and troubleshooting.
- Collaborate with 3rd party vendors and other IT domains to ensure infrastructure security meets regulatory, bank, and industry standards.
- Conduct continuous monitoring, regular self-assessments, and provide support upon escalation.
- Implement best practices for infrastructure design, support, and operation (on-premises and cloud).
- Schedule and manage frequent internal vulnerability assessments and penetration tests.
- Develop, measure, and monitor IT system availability and performance standards.
Qualifications and Experience
- Minimum Bachelor's degree in IT / Computer Science / Engineering or equivalent from an HEC recognized institution. A Master's degree or relevant certifications are preferred.
- Minimum 04 years of experience in IT Infrastructure Operations / Security, preferably within the banking sector.
Skills and Expertise
- Sound understanding of Cyber Security, Log Analysis, Incident Handling, Ethical Hacking, Cybersecurity Techniques, Vulnerability Scanning, SIEM, Email Security, Antivirus, IPS/IDS, AMP, WAF, Operating Systems, Network Security Controls, Scripting etc.
- Expertise in managing security and compliance aspects of IT infrastructure.
- Strong analytical, decision-making, problem-solving, team, and time management skills.
- Proficiency in MS Office Suite (Outlook, Excel, Word, PowerPoint).
- Desire to work in a cohesive, high-performing team and a passion for learning and growth.
